CAS 256935-86-1
:6-Chloro-1H-indole-5-carboxylic acid
Description:
6-Chloro-1H-indole-5-carboxylic acid is an organic compound characterized by its indole structure, which consists of a fused benzene and pyrrole ring. The presence of a chlorine atom at the 6-position and a carboxylic acid group at the 5-position contributes to its unique chemical properties. This compound is typically a white to off-white solid and is soluble in polar solvents, which can facilitate its use in various chemical reactions and applications. It is often utilized in medicinal chemistry and research due to its potential biological activity, particularly in the development of pharmaceuticals. The carboxylic acid functional group allows for further derivatization, making it a versatile intermediate in organic synthesis. Additionally, the chlorine substituent can influence the compound's reactivity and interaction with biological targets. As with many chemical substances, proper handling and safety precautions should be observed, as it may exhibit toxicity or environmental hazards.
Formula:C9H6ClNO2
InChI:InChI=1S/C9H6ClNO2/c10-7-4-8-5(1-2-11-8)3-6(7)9(12)13/h1-4,11H,(H,12,13)
InChI key:InChIKey=PNQNYTQRGUBNTG-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:C(O)(=O)C=1C=C2C(=CC1Cl)NC=C2
Synonyms:- 1H-Indole-5-carboxylic acid, 6-chloro-
- 6-chloro-1H-Indole-5-carboxylic acid
